Responsibilities:

The Senior Accountant will primarily assist the AC in the coordination and processing of the University’s monthly financial statement and reporting activities along with the preparation of supporting schedules, performing analysis of revenues and expenditures and assisting in the documentation and monitoring of internal controls.     

Essential functions:  100% of time
  • Assists the AC with the monthly close and the preparation of the financial statements.
  • Prepares monthly bank reconciliations for each account.
  • Prepares monthly journal entries – accruals, prepaids, insurance, depreciation calculation, CIP, etc.
  • Ensures that monthly P-Card file is uploaded to Banner and that charges are correctly applied.
  • Reconciles federal work study funds monthly.
  • Works with Accounts Payable staff to ensure that A/P is reconciled to General Ledger monthly. 
  • Posts positive pay files, follows up on ACH/CC deposits/reconciling items.
  • Post federal aid cash and return of funds transactions.
  • Prepare federal aid draws.
  • Maintains cash receipts by ensuring that each cashiering session is reconciled and closed out properly.
  • Works with A/R staff to ensure that student accounts receivable is reconciled to the general ledger monthly.
  • Assists in the reconciliation of all balance sheet accounts.  
  • Assists with special projects as necessary.
